Explanation / Answer

Cost of plant at time A (Ca)= $15 million

Construction Cost index (Ia) = 4535

Construction Cost Index at time B (Ib) = 4535 * (1.068^10) = 8755.6787 = 8755.68

Let Cost of plant at Time B = Cb

We know: Ca/Cb = Ia/Ib

Cb=(Ca*Ib) / Ia = (15*8755.68)/4535 = $ 28.96 million

So Cost of plant at Time B = $28.96 million
